Daftar Isi
Dalam alam keamanan, memahami cara mengamankan API dari serangan adalah tahap awal yang sangat krusial, khususnya bagi mereka yang baru mulai. API (Application Programming Interface) merupakan penghubung komunikasi antara aplikasi, dan jika apabila tidak dilindungi secara efektif, dapat menjadi sasaran mudah untuk hacker. Dengan alasan itu, artikel ini akan membahas secara mendalam metode melindungi API dari serangan dengan strategi yang praktis dan mudah dipahami.
Dengan bertambahnya jumlah program yang bergantung pada Antarmuka Pemrograman Aplikasi, krusial bagi setiap pengembang untuk mengetahui bagaimana mengamankan Antarmuka Pemrograman Aplikasi dari ancaman yang potensial terjadi. Baik itu ancaman DDoS, injeksi SQL, atau metode lain yang mungkin merusak, kami akan menyampaikan strategi dan langkah-langkah terbaik untuk menjaga Antarmuka Pemrograman Aplikasi Anda dari ancaman tersebut. Mari kita eksplorasi metode mengamankan API dari ancaman agar program Anda tetap aman.
Mengetahui Konsep Keamanan Api Listrik: Dasar-dasar yg Harus Dimengerti
Proteksi antarmuka pemrograman aplikasi merupakan sebuah aspek krusial di pengembangan software kontemporer, terutama seiring bertambahnya ancaman cyber yang menargetkan program berbasis internet. Cara melindungi antarmuka pemrograman aplikasi terhadap ancaman harus diketahui oleh setiap developer serta praktisi teknologi informasi. Dengan mengetahui dasar-dasar keamanan, kami bisa menciptakan sistem yang lebih lebih tangguh terhadap berbagai jenis menyusup, misalnya injeksi SQL dan ancaman DDoS. Pemahaman tersebut bukan hanya memperbaiki keamanan aplikasi, tetapi juga memperkuat keyakinan pengguna terhadap sistem yang bangun.
sebuah langkah awal untuk cara melindungi api dari serangan ialah dengan menerapkan autentikasi serta izin yang ketat. Menggunakan token secure, misalkan Token Web JSON (JSON Web Tokens), bisa membantu menjamin hanya hanya pengguna yang authorized yang bisa bisa masuk ke sumber daya tertentu. Di samping itu, mengendalikan aksesibilitas berdasarkan peran user pun merupakan strategi efektif efektif dalam mencegah akses yang tidak sah. Dengan mengadopsi prinsip ini, kita dapat mengharapkan kualitas keamanan api milik kita bakal naik secara signifikan.
Di samping itu, metode mengamankan api terhadap serangan juga pengujian keamanan secara rutin. Dengan melakukan evaluasi kerentanan dan juga pengujian penetrasi dapat membantu mengidentifikasi kekurangan yang ada sebelum itu dieksploitasi oleh pihak penyerang. Dengan secara memperhatikan elemen keamanan ini secara rutin secara berkelanjutan dan menerapkan update yang dibutuhkan, kita dapat menjaga integritas dan keamanan infrastruktur api milik kita. Pada umumnya, pemahaman tentang konsep fundamental keselamatan api dan juga strategi mengamankan API dari sangat penting untuk kesuksesan dan keselamatan sistem TI.
Langkah-langkah Efektif dalam rangka Memperkuat Perlindungan Sistem
Agar meningkatkan proteksi sistem Anda Anda, salah satu tindakan utama adalah melaksanakan cara mengamankan API terhadap serangan. API yang tidak aman bisa jadi jalan masuk untuk penyerang untuk mengeksploitasi sistem anda. Oleh karena itu, krusial untuk memahami cara memproteksi API dari yang sering terjadi misalnya serangan SQL dan serangan DDoS. Dengan menerapkan otentikasi kekuatan dan enkripsi data, Anda dapat menyediakan lapisan perlindungan ekstra pada antarmuka pemrograman aplikasi Anda.
Tahap selanjutnya dalam cara mengamankan API dari ancaman adalah dengan pemadam kebakaran program web (WAF). WAF mampu membantu mengidentifikasi dan menghalangi ancaman berbahaya sebelum menjangkau API milik Anda. Di samping itu, selalu krusial untuk memperbarui dan memelihara sistem Anda, sebab sejumlah serangan memanfaatkan celah pada versi yang lebih lama perangkat yang usang. Dengan cara mengimplementasikan metode mengamankan API dari ancaman, milik Anda juga menunjukkan komitmen terhadap perlindungan data pengguna.
Akhirnya, penting agar menjalankan tes security dengan rutin terhadap API yang Anda kelola. Metode menjaga API terhadap yang merugikan tidak hanya di tahap implementasi, melainkan juga perlu meliputi tes bersama dengan evaluasi sistem rutin. Melalui melakukan tes penetrasi dan penilaian keamanan, Anda bisa mendeteksi potensi celah dan mengatasi sebelum sempat disalahgunakan. Dengan, Anda dapat melestarikan safety antarmuka pemrograman aplikasi serta menjaga data sensitif terhadap yang merugikan.
Cara dan Strategi Menangani Ancaman Keamanan Api dengan Efektif
Dalam konteks dunia digital yang semakin kompleks, upaya melindungi antarmuka pemrograman aplikasi dari ancaman jadi semakin penting. Risiko keamanan sebagai contoh serangan DDoS, serangan melalui injeksi SQL, serta ekploitasi API meningkat pesat. Untuk memastikan keamanan software Anda, penting untuk memahami berbagai cara dan strategi untuk menjamin agar API Anda tetap terjaga dari ancaman berbagai kemungkinan bahaya yang mengintai.
Salah satu metode mengamankan antarmuka pemrograman aplikasi terhadap serangan merupakan dengan menerapkan sistem autentikasi serta otorisasi yang kuat. Dengan memanfaatkan protokol seperti OAuth 2.0 dan JSON Web Token, anda dapat memastikan bahwasanya cuma pengguna yang terverifikasi yang dapat mengakses informasi sensitif melalui antarmuka pemrograman aplikasi. Di samping itu, sangat penting agar menerapkan pembatasan laju agar dapat menghindari serangan paksa kasar dan memastikan bahwasanya pemakaian antarmuka pemrograman aplikasi tidak melewati batas yang telah ditentukan.
Kemudian, mengupdate dan memelihara keamanan API secara berkala adalah langkah penting dalam upaya melindungi API terhadap serangan. Melaksanakan audit keamanan dan tes penetrasi keamanan secara berkala bisa membantu Anda menemukan kekurangan yang mungkin ada sebelum dieksploitasi oleh yang tidak memiliki tanggung jawab. Jangan melupakan juga untuk senantiasa memantau log masuk API untuk menemukan aktivitas mencurigakan dengan cepat dan cepat tanggap.